Key Responsibilities
- Manage daily store operations, including receiving, storage, and issuance of raw materials, consumables, spare parts, and finished goods.
- Ensure proper inventory control and stock accuracy.
- Monitor minimum/maximum stock levels and coordinate replenishment.
- Maintain FIFO/FEFO practices where applicable.
- Conduct regular physical stock counts and reconciliation.
Material Handling & Documentation
- Verify GRNs, material receipts, delivery challans, and issuance records.
- Ensure proper documentation of inward and outward inventory movement.
- Coordinate with procurement, production, and warehouse teams for smooth material flow.
- Maintain organized storage and material identification systems.
ERP & Reporting
- Update inventory transactions in ERP/software systems accurately.
- Prepare daily, weekly, and monthly inventory and consumption reports.
- Analyze stock variances and report discrepancies.
- Support audit requirements and compliance documentation.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Commerce, Business Administration, or related field.
- 3–6 years of experience in manufacturing plant stores/warehouse operations.
- Strong knowledge of inventory management practices.
- Experience with ERP systems (SAP, Oracle, Odoo, or similar).
- Good command of MS Excel and reporting.
- Strong coordination and problem-solving skills.
